What about the rooms?
 
Are you choosing between an AoA family suite or a standard LM room? I would choose the family suite over CSR but CSR over a LM room at AoA.

During our June stay at CSR, we had great bus service but we were in the casitas section. Had we stayed in cabanas I might have had a different opinion as every morning our bus was standing room only by the time we got to the third stop and we sometimes did not even go to bus stop #4 because we were so full. You just never know with bus service at WDW.

I stayed at Coronado a long time ago and am driving back from a week long stay at AOA. I wrote about it on this thread a few days ago (AOA tips from a Mom of 5)
Our kids are similar ages (mine are 10, 8, and 4) we were VERY comfortable space wise. When our youngest napped in the bedroom the older 2 could be watching tv in the other room. Nice to have the kitchenette too.
The ONLY downside (and I think a lot of people would disagree) is it felt kinda "value" to me. But maybe it's just because it was really crowded there.
